It appears that next season may bring a new face to the halls of the Arconia. According to Deadline, Jesse Williams, formerly of Grey’s Anatomy, has joined the cast of Only Murders in the Building for its upcoming third season. The second season of the Hulu series concluded in August, and it appears that some secrets are already in the works for the next third season. Williams portrays a documentary filmmaker who develops an interest in the subject Mabel Mora, Charles Haden-Savage, and Oliver Putman are investigating for their apartment building podcast.
Williams spent a total of twelve years as a regular cast member on the hit ABC medical drama Grey’s Anatomy. Williams portrayed Dr Jackson Avery in the medical drama series set at a hospital. In addition to his acting career, he has starred in various films, including the underground hit The Cabin in the Woods. In addition to his acting work, Williams has also worked as a teacher & an activist. For his performance in the Broadway version of Take Me Out, he was just nominated for a Tony Award. Hulu’s only big hit is Murders in the Building. Starring Selena Gomez, Martin Short, and Steve Martin, the show centres on three polar opposites who share a luxury apartment on the West Side of Manhattan.
The first season followed the three of them as they worked together to investigate a murder in their building and maintained a podcast about their experiences. Season 2 of the show launched this past summer, and it featured the trio as potential suspects in a murder. Special guest stars like Shirley MacLaine piled up during the show’s second season. The second season of the show also included Amy Schumer and Cara Delevingne. Williams’s appointment is the first major casting announcement for the upcoming third season, which will begin filming before the year’s end. In July of this year, only Murders in the Building was renewed for a third season. 20th Television is responsible for making the show.
This season, the show received a total of 17 Emmy nominations and took home three awards. Steve Martin, who stars in the sitcom, and John Hoffman conceived it together. Short, Gomez, Dan Fogelman, and Jess Rosenthal serve as executive producers for the show, and Martin is one of them as well. There has been no confirmation of when Season 3 will begin airing.
